Supreme Court Advocate files complaint against Papon

Runa Bhuyan, Advocate, who gave her address as 14, Lawyers Chamber (Old), Supreme Court of India has filed a complaint to National Commission for Protection of Child Rights, against renowned singer of Assam, Angarag Papon Mahanta for his 'inappropriate' act of showing affection to a minor girl.

The complaint reads that the content of the video where Papon was seen planting a kiss on an adolescent girl child, who is a contestant of the show Voice of India Kids, contains 'objectionable' content.

Runa Bhuyan, in the complaint said, "I am shocked to see the behaviour of the said singer Angarag Papon Mahanta towards a minor girl where he is seen to be applying colors on  a minor girl and inapprpriately kissing the said girl. On seeing the video, I am seriously concerned regarding the safety and security of minor girl participating in reality shows across India."

Speaking to G Plus, Miguel Das Queah, Founder and Chairman of UTSAH, said, "Regardless of affection or no affection, I request male celebrities to refrain from pulling the cheeks and kissing the faces of adolescent girl children (especially of children who are not your own). One should understand that just because children cannot express their emotions, one should not take full advantage of it. In fact, girl children do not like to be touched. If you were to do the same to an adult, an FIR would've come your way. So please hold your love and affection, which can very well be expressed without laying your hands and mouth on girl children."
